Reservoir
The Wienerwaldsee is a shallow , located 20 kilometres west of , . It is located just north of Austria's main motorway, the West Autobahn, between and Neu-Purkersdorf.

Town
is a town in the district of St. Pölten-Land in the state of . In 1881, Johannes Brahms completed his Second Piano Concerto while in the town. It belonged to Wien-Umgebung District which was dissolved at the end of 2016.
